DISTRICT POLICY for PROMOTION

Any 8th grade student who receives two failing grades (F’s) or two unsatisfactory (U) citizenship grades in the same two classes for the first semester will have his/her progress reviewed in those classes at the last progress report of the 2nd semester.

If the “F” and “U” grade remain in both classes, the student shall be excluded from all promotion exercises, activities, and ceremonies.

Students suspended from school during the last 9 weeks may be excluded from promotion exercises and end of year activities.

CAHSEE

California High School Exit Examination Taken in grade 10 Can be repeated in grades 11 and 12 Focus on language arts and math Math mostly at Algebra level Need to pass the test to graduate
